The first time Byulyi saw her. She found her intrinsically majestic—as if she was a masterpiece etched with delicate by Leonardo Da Vinci himself. No one else comes close to her beauty, even Seulgi whom she pined on for weeks during her freshman days.

“Hi. I’m Moon Byulyi.” She managed to utter before her embarrassed wits got the best of her. Byulyi’s hand quivered nervously, which she tried to cease with her other hand, as she waited for the beauty to reply.

“Uh- hello! I’m Kim Yongsun. I just got here… apparently,” she laughed, finding her latter statement unnecessary.

Byulyi tried her best to resist the wide smile itching to curve over her lips but, with the way Yongsun was melodically laughing, she knew she just lost the battle. She was afraid Yongsun would find her grin disturbing but it seems not when the latter flashed a toothy beam of her own.

At that moment her stomach churned severely, she even thought of excusing herself to the bathroom, but that would mean a moment of not seeing Yongsun so she opted to stay for a while more. Besides she figured it wasn’t that kind of churning but the kind of churning wherein butterflies were fluttering all over her insides.

“Anyway it’s a pleasure to meet you, Byuly-ssi! I don’t really have many friends here.” Yongsun then took her newfound companion’s hand and shook it—the cordial smile never leaving her face. She waited patiently for a reply but it seems the grin on Byulyi’s face was all she’s going to receive. Yongsun found the sight of her dreamy expression amusing so she let out a soft laugh before waving her hand over in front of the latter’s face.

That must have done the trick as Byulyi quickly shook her head and regained composure. An almost unnoticeable blush rose on her cheeks, when she realized she had just explicitly stared at Yongsun.

“Y-yes,” she replied as she gave Yongsun’s hand a firm shake in spite of her previous tongue tied moment. She didn’t knew she could miss someone just as much as she missed Yongsun after they lost connection—even though they were still literally inches apart.

 

 

 

It had been a year since Byulyi met Yongsun. She even remembered the exact date of the momentous event but that was something for her diary to only know.

“You ready?” Byulyi queried as she sat patiently on the couch.

She was wearing a blue sweater with white stripes matched with Yongsun’s own which previewed a pink shade instead of blue. They bought the outfit awhile back in courtesy of Yongsun because she was tempted by the buy 1 take 1 sign, whilst Byulyi only readily agreed because it made them look like a couple.

“One more minute!” Yongsun yelled as she hurriedly puckered her lips and applied lipstick. Once she was satisfied with her look, she left the vanity area and went to Byulyi, casually tapping her shoulder to announce her readiness.

The younger glanced up in anticipation from her phone to Yongsun, and a wide smile quickly adorned on her lips when she witnessed the beauty the latter possessed.

“I don’t even know why you love make-up so much. You look perfect even without one,” Byulyi remarked. It really was true, Yongsun was gorgeous even without make-up, in fact, Byulyi does her best to wake up earlier just to revel at her alluring features (however creepy that sounded).

“Stop with the grease, Byul! You’re just saying that because I’m wearing one,” Yongsun retorted as she playfully hit the younger’s shoulders. She noticed Byulyi’s mouth opening to reply at her statement, probably with her greasy comebacks again, so she quickly added, “Leggo! We’re going to screw the itinerary.”

Instead of retaliating, Byulyi just chuckled at the prominent avoidance as she chucked herself out the couch and draped her arm over Yongsun’s shoulder before going out.

They spent the day comfortably in the premises of the town. It wasn’t their first time to explore the city but it would be a lie if they said they didn’t enjoy the familiar sights.

Before the day ended, Byulyi pulled the older to her motorcycle and drove to her favorite place. It was an underrated diner by the sides of the coastal highway, but food wasn’t the best thing it offered, rather it was the sight by the back of it.

Byulyi glanced at her watch before mentally praising herself that they got them there just in time.

“Are you trying to kill us?! You almost crashed into a car back there!” Obviously the latter was just an exaggerated lie because Byulyi had always been careful, but she expressed a quirky laughter to appease the elder’s displeasure.

“Whatever, unnie,” she rolled her eyes as she helped her remove the helmet before dragging her to the seawall. “If this isn’t enough to pacify your frustrations, I don’t know what will.” Byulyi wondered at the picturesque sight—red orange hue coloring the skies and sparkling blue water reflecting the same hues.

“Wow…” That was the only word Yongsun uttered as she watched in pure awe at nature’s beauty. Byulyi only wanted to glance at Yongsun to shot her a smug smirk but it seems nature has finally found its competition.

She was rendered speechless at Yongsun’s splendor needless to say. As sappy as it seems, Byulyi wanted time to stop right there and then. In fact she could spend an eternity staring at Yongsun, and trust her, she wouldn’t want to have it any other way.

However time seems not to be on her side because only minutes after, the sun has set and replaced by the moon.

“I know I’m pretty and everything but I don’t want to melt just yet,” Yongsun said as she looked at the younger. It seems that Byulyi didn’t do a good job of disguising her stare nor hiding her reddening cheeks, which Yongsun dismissed as a spontaneous reaction against the cold breeze.

“And I don’t want you to melt as well or else I won’t have an eye candy to stare at any time I like,” she replied greasily all the while trying her best to compose herself.

As usual, Yongsun rolled her eyes and hit her best friend’s shoulder without any remorse whilst yelling, “What are you saying? That was so greasy!”

Byulyi did her best to block off the fists but her hands weren’t doing so much of shielding herself, so she opted to embrace the woman. Luckily, the action seem to have done the job as Yongsun’s arms were rendered useless.

“Let go of me, you greasy star!” Yongsun playfully and overdramatically shouted despite the fact that she was actually enjoying the warmth of the hug.

“Never! I don’t want to die by your heavy hands.” A melodious teasing laughter drifted away Byulyi’s voice box.

“Oh you! Just wait ‘till I escape,” she replied in a fake offended tone.

“If you even manage to. I won’t let you go now even if you want me to and beg me to.” Byulyi kidded—or rather soundly hinted at her unrequited feelings.

Yongsun again let out a screech of inauthentic disgust, which made the younger tighten her embrace.

“And even if you do your puppy looks, I wouldn’t let you go.”

“That means I’m stuck to you then.”

“Definitely! No matter what,” Byulyi responded as she leaned back a little to peck the elder’s cheek—a normal portrayal of affection between them, before gliding towards her back so that they were both facing the sea horizon.

Yongsun merely chuckled in defeat as she let herself relish in the warmth of the younger's arms. They stayed a couple minutes in that position whilst exchanging (flirtatious) playful banters before hesitatingly separating to fill their deprived appetites by the diner.
